Output e521555432cf892bb936b8d5a42e2fa2b567b6852537f729ddfd07c31398f010:1

value
510311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c0ec9e8341fdee0c83f7bc997225387bd20621f OP_EQUAL
address
38dAzfDXi76cwjkZcmHnuDoG92AYf946Ud
transaction
e521555432cf892bb936b8d5a42e2fa2b567b6852537f729ddfd07c31398f010
confirmations
20220
spent
true